Director of a Dental | Medicaid Non-Profit

Turabify Co.
Franklin, OH

We are seeking an experienced and passionate Director of a Dental program for our Medicaid Non-Profit organization based in Franklin, OH. This leadership position is crucial for driving the mission of accessible dental care for underserved populations in our community. As the Director, you will be responsible for overseeing the overall operations, strategy, and development of our dental services. Your key responsibilities will include managing program staff, ensuring compliance with state and federal regulations, and developing partnerships with local organizations and stakeholders. You will also be tasked with developing and implementing initiatives that expand access to dental care for Medicaid recipients while fostering a culture of excellence and compassion within the team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in public health, dental services, and non-profit management. If you are a strategic thinker with a commitment to improving health outcomes for vulnerable populations, we invite you to apply for this vital role at Turabify Co.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ee the daily operations of the Medicaid dental program, ensuring quality patient care and operational efficiency.
  • Develop and implement strategic plans to enhance service delivery and expand access to dental care.
  • Lead and manage a team of dental professionals and administrative staff, fostering a collaborative and positive work environment.
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able regulations and standards related to Medicaid services and dental care.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with community partners, stakeholders, and government agencies.
  • Monitor program performance, analyze data, and prepare reports to inform strategic decisions and grant applications.
  • Advocate for the needs of the community and represent the dental program at community events and meetings.

Requirements

  • experience in dental care management or public health programs, with a focus on Medicaid services.
  • Demonstrated leadership skills and experience managing teams in a healthcare or non-profit environment.
  • Strong understanding of Medicaid regulations, dental health disparities, and community health initiatives.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and advocacy skills to engage with diverse stakeholders.
  • Proficient in data analysis, program evaluation, and grant writing.
  • Passion for improving access to dental care and a commitment to community service.
